.MoleculeAnimationComponent-module__ISbVNq__componentWrapper{width:100%;height:100%}.MoleculeAnimationComponent-module__ISbVNq__scene{height:100%;position:relative}.MoleculeAnimationComponent-module__ISbVNq__scene canvas{z-index:0;background:0 0;border:none;outline:none;display:block;position:absolute;top:-.9px;left:0;box-shadow:unset!important}.MoleculeAnimationComponent-module__ISbVNq__box{cursor:move;background:#fff;width:40px;height:40px;position:absolute}.MoleculeAnimationComponent-module__ISbVNq__ground{background:#666;width:400px;height:120px;position:absolute;top:140px}
.MoleculeHomeComponent-module__iKfVka__container{background-image:url(/swirls-3-orange-transparent.svg);background-position:right 0 top 324px;background-repeat:no-repeat;flex-direction:column;justify-content:center;min-height:100vh;padding:0 .5rem;display:flex}.MoleculeHomeComponent-module__iKfVka__main{flex-direction:column;flex:4;align-items:start;height:100%;padding:0;display:flex}.MoleculeHomeComponent-module__iKfVka__main:before{background-image:url(/swirls-2.svg);border:10px solid orange;width:100%;height:100%;position:absolute;inset:0}.MoleculeHomeComponent-module__iKfVka__contentWrapper{z-index:10;position:relative}.MoleculeHomeComponent-module__iKfVka__introHeaderContainer{align-items:start;width:100%;max-width:36rem;margin:0;padding:0 3rem;font-size:3rem}.MoleculeHomeComponent-module__iKfVka__introHeaderContainer h1{letter-spacing:-4px;-webkit-user-select:none;user-select:none;margin:2rem;font-size:4rem;line-height:91px}.MoleculeHomeComponent-module__iKfVka__introTextContainer{margin:0 3rem 3rem;-webkit-user-select:none;user-select:none;max-width:44rem;margin-block-start:1rem;padding:0 2rem;position:relative}.MoleculeHomeComponent-module__iKfVka__withAnimation{transition:color .15s,border-color .15s}.MoleculeHomeComponent-module__iKfVka__introTextContainer p,.MoleculeHomeComponent-module__iKfVka__introTextContainer ul{margin:2rem 0}.MoleculeHomeComponent-module__iKfVka__withAnimation li{display:inline-block}.MoleculeHomeComponent-module__iKfVka__introTextContainer mark{background-color:#00d1ff5c}.MoleculeHomeComponent-module__iKfVka__inline{display:inline}.MoleculeHomeComponent-module__iKfVka__highlight{background-color:var(--secondary-highlight-transparent-80);color:var(--secondary-highlight-inverse)}.MoleculeHomeComponent-module__iKfVka__highlight2{background-color:var(--primary-highlight-transparent);color:var(--secondary-highlight-inverse)}span.MoleculeHomeComponent-module__iKfVka__highlight{padding:5px;line-height:2.5rem}p.MoleculeHomeComponent-module__iKfVka__highlight{padding:5px;line-height:2rem}.MoleculeHomeComponent-module__iKfVka__title a{color:#0070f3;text-decoration:none}.MoleculeHomeComponent-module__iKfVka__title a:hover,.MoleculeHomeComponent-module__iKfVka__title a:focus,.MoleculeHomeComponent-module__iKfVka__title a:active{text-decoration:underline}.MoleculeHomeComponent-module__iKfVka__title{margin:0;font-size:4rem;line-height:1.15}.MoleculeHomeComponent-module__iKfVka__title,.MoleculeHomeComponent-module__iKfVka__description{text-align:center}.MoleculeHomeComponent-module__iKfVka__description{font-size:1.5rem;line-height:1.5}.MoleculeHomeComponent-module__iKfVka__code{background:#fafafa;border-radius:5px;padding:.75rem;font-family:Menlo,Monaco,Lucida Console,Liberation Mono,DejaVu Sans Mono,Bitstream Vera Sans Mono,Courier New,monospace;font-size:1.1rem}.MoleculeHomeComponent-module__iKfVka__grid{flex-wrap:wrap;justify-content:center;margin-top:2rem;display:flex}.MoleculeHomeComponent-module__iKfVka__card{text-align:left;color:inherit;border:1px solid #eaeaea;border-radius:5px;flex-basis:45%;margin:1rem;padding:1.5rem;text-decoration:none;transition:color .15s,border-color .15s}.MoleculeHomeComponent-module__iKfVka__card:hover,.MoleculeHomeComponent-module__iKfVka__card:focus,.MoleculeHomeComponent-module__iKfVka__card:active{color:#ab7351;border-color:#ab7351}.MoleculeHomeComponent-module__iKfVka__card .MoleculeHomeComponent-module__iKfVka__titlesWrapper{flex-direction:row;align-items:center;display:flex}.MoleculeHomeComponent-module__iKfVka__card img{border:1px solid #65646324;margin:0 10px 10px 0}.MoleculeHomeComponent-module__iKfVka__card img .MoleculeHomeComponent-module__iKfVka__errorThumb{border:5px solid #ab7351}.MoleculeHomeComponent-module__iKfVka__card h3,.MoleculeHomeComponent-module__iKfVka__card h4{margin:0;font-size:1rem}.MoleculeHomeComponent-module__iKfVka__card .MoleculeHomeComponent-module__iKfVka__label{background-color:#cdbfae;border-radius:25px;margin:15px 2px 5px;padding:5px 10px;font-size:.8rem;font-weight:400;display:inline-block}.MoleculeHomeComponent-module__iKfVka__card p{margin:0;font-size:.9rem;line-height:1.5}.MoleculeHomeComponent-module__iKfVka__logo{height:1em}.MoleculeHomeComponent-module__iKfVka__dialog{background-color:#b7943d;width:100vw;height:100vw;position:fixed;top:0;left:0}.MoleculeHomeComponent-module__iKfVka__firstline{initial-letter:1.5 2;display:block}@media (max-width:600px){.MoleculeHomeComponent-module__iKfVka__grid{flex-direction:column;width:100%}.MoleculeHomeComponent-module__iKfVka__main{padding:1rem 0 0}.MoleculeHomeComponent-module__iKfVka__introHeaderContainer{padding:0;font-size:2rem}.MoleculeHomeComponent-module__iKfVka__introTextContainer{margin:0;padding-bottom:3rem}.MoleculeHomeComponent-module__iKfVka__introHeaderContainer h1{font-size:3rem}.MoleculeHomeComponent-module__iKfVka__introTextContainer h2{font-size:1.1rem}}
.MoleculeDebugComponent-module__Buadwq__debugWrapper{opacity:.5;z-index:5;background:#fff;width:100%;height:50px;position:fixed;bottom:0}
